I have one of these cameras without the Camera (type B? USB ?) to PC (type A
male USB) cable. the mini connector marked AV at the side of the camera
*looks* like a mini USB connector. Can anyone confirm that this is a
standard mini USB connector pinout lead ?

AFAIK, there are only 2 USB plugs that are smaller than the normal "D" plug.
One is 6.5mm by 3mm OD, and there is a smaller one 5mm by 1.5mm OD. The
Panasonic is usually the smaller one.
